What is the Cambridge Lions Shed’s connection to charity shops in New Zealand?

The Cambridge Lions Shed, run by the local Lions Club, supports community wellbeing by providing a safe, social space for men to connect and work on meaningful projects, much like how charity shops in New Zealand support social causes through fundraising. While it isn’t a retail charity shop itself, it shares the same spirit of community service and reinvesting in local needs, such as health initiatives and support for vulnerable residents.

Are there volunteer opportunities available at the Cambridge Lions Shed?

Yes, the Cambridge Lions Shed welcomes volunteers, particularly men who enjoy woodworking, crafting, or simply sharing conversation in a supportive environment. Volunteering here means contributing to a vital men’s health initiative, helping reduce isolation while creating useful items for raffles or donations—perfect for those wanting to give back in a hands-on, meaningful way.
